About the Role
The role involves leading mobile development efforts with a strong focus on product quality, performance, and user experience. The engineer will work closely with cross-functional teams to build and scale React Native applications, ensuring robust architecture and seamless functionality across platforms.
Responsibilities
- Lead the design and implementation of mobile applications using React Native
- Collaborate with product managers to define feature requirements
- Optimize application performance across Android and iOS platforms
- Ensure code quality through testing and peer reviews
- Mentor junior developers and support team growth
- Troubleshoot and resolve mobile-specific issues
- Implement secure authentication and data handling practices
- Integrate third-party libraries and native modules
- Work closely with designers to deliver intuitive user interfaces
- Maintain up-to-date documentation for code and processes
- Stay current with mobile development trends and tools
- Participate in agile planning and sprint execution
- Contribute to architectural decisions for mobile stack
- Support deployment and monitoring of production apps
- Improve accessibility and localization features
- Evaluate and adopt new mobile technologies
- Ensure compliance with platform-specific guidelines
- Collaborate on backend integration for APIs and services
- Drive improvements in build and release pipelines
- Gather and act on user feedback for product iteration
- Assist in defining mobile testing strategies
- Contribute to open-source projects when applicable
- Maintain consistency across mobile and web experiences
- Support customer-facing teams with technical insights
- Participate in on-call rotations for critical issues
Nice to Have
- Experience with TypeScript in mobile projects
- Contributions to open-source React Native projects
- Familiarity with mobile design systems
- Experience with automated UI testing
- Knowledge of mobile DevOps practices
- Background in startup or fast-paced environments
- Experience mentoring engineers remotely
- Familiarity with Jamstack architectures
- Understanding of mobile A/B testing frameworks
- Experience with over-the-air updates
Compensation
Competitive salary with equity and comprehensive benefits
Work Arrangement
Hybrid remote with optional office locations
Team
Cross-functional product team focused on mobile innovation
Our Mobile Philosophy
- We prioritize user-centric design and smooth performance in every mobile release
- Our team values clean architecture and long-term maintainability over quick fixes
Engineering Culture
- We practice iterative development with frequent user feedback
- Engineers are encouraged to propose and lead technical initiatives
- We value documentation, code reviews, and knowledge sharing
Available for qualified candidates